Why Choose a Learn Korean Vlog Approach?
Vlogs, or video blogs, offer a dynamic and visually engaging method to absorb a language, especially Korean. Unlike traditional textbooks or audio-only resources, vlogs provide:
- Contextual Learning: Seeing and hearing Korean in everyday settings helps learners understand how language functions in real conversations.
- Pronunciation and Intonation: Observing native speakers’ mouth movements and intonation patterns enhances speaking skills.
- Cultural Insights: Korean culture is deeply intertwined with its language, and vlogs often showcase customs, food, festivals, and social norms.
- Motivation and Engagement: Following vloggers’ personal stories and experiences makes learning more relatable and less monotonous.
These benefits make learn Korean vlog content a powerful tool for learners at any stage, from beginners to advanced speakers.

Top Tips to Maximize Your Learn Korean Vlog Experience
Using vlogs effectively requires strategy and consistency. Here are actionable tips to enhance your learning:
1. Choose Relevant Vlogs
Focus on vlog content that matches your current level and interests. For beginners, look for videos with clear speech and basic vocabulary. Intermediate and advanced learners can explore complex topics like Korean history, pop culture, or daily life.
2. Engage Actively with Content
Don’t passively watch. Take notes, repeat phrases aloud, and practice shadowing (mimicking the speaker’s speech). Use Talkpal’s interactive features to deepen your understanding.
3. Incorporate Vocabulary Review
After watching, review new words and phrases using Talkpal’s built-in flashcards or spaced repetition system. This reinforces retention and usage.
4. Practice Speaking Regularly
Apply what you’ve learned by speaking with native speakers via Talkpal’s live sessions or language exchange partners. Speaking practice is crucial to internalize vocabulary and improve pronunciation.
5. Immerse Yourself in Korean Culture
Supplement vlogs with Korean music, dramas, and news to diversify exposure. Understanding cultural nuances enhances your ability to use the language appropriately.
